tabletop
Version:
**Tabletop.js** takes a Google Spreadsheet and makes it easily accessible through JavaScript. With zero dependencies!
32 lines (25 loc) • 990 B
HTML
<html>
<body>
<p id="food"></p>
<script type="text/javascript" src="../../src/tabletop.js"></script>
<script type="text/javascript">
var public_spreadsheet_url = 'https://docs.google.com/spreadsheets/d/1w3kxJ3OetcTlbAeQ_ltXgf2zLlaQztbDRdrrBdowLEs/edit';
function init() {
Tabletop.init( {
key: public_spreadsheet_url,
simpleSheet: true,
callback: examineColumns
})
}
function examineColumns(data, tabletop) {
console.log(data)
console.log(tabletop.sheets()['Sheet1'].prettyColumns)
console.log(tabletop.sheets()['Sheet1'].columnNames)
console.log(tabletop.sheets()['Sheet1'].originalColumns)
}
window.addEventListener('DOMContentLoaded', init)
document.write("The published spreadsheet is located at <a target='_new' href='" + public_spreadsheet_url + "'>" + public_spreadsheet_url + "</a>");
</script>
</body>
</html>